油气田用往复压缩机无固定基础安装的结构设计及应用

Structural Design and Application of Reciprocating Compressor without Fixed Foundation Installation for Oil and Gas Field
下载PDF
导出
摘要 阐述了油气田用固定基础及无固定基础压缩机在橇体结构及安装方面的差异,根据压缩机橇体的结构特征进行了地基土层的承载力计算,并进一步对引起压缩机振动的动载荷进行了分析核算,提出了压缩机橇体结构及安装基础结构的设计建议。 This paper described the differences in skid structure and installation of compressors with or not fixed foundations for oil and gas fields. Based on the structural characteristics of compressor skids, the bearing capacity of the foundation soil layer was calculated. The dynamic load causing compressor vibation in further was analyzed and calculated. The design suggestions of the compressor skid structure and installation foundation structure were put forward.
